PPOC-BC Spotlight on Newly Accredited Members for Wildlife

Today’s spotlight is on Heather Rolling , who became a member June of 2024. She received her Wildlife Accreditation in June of 2025. This would be her first accreditation.

Heather is based out of Northern B.C. in Fort St. John . She started her photography journey with her first DSLR in July of 2022 . She is a heavy haul truck driver , mostly in backwood areas so her camera makes a lot of miles with her . She has a passion for wildlife , nature , and the outdoors . She enjoys learning and tries to better her craft, learning more about her camera and settings , composition for better images.

Heather’s journey is newer and still developing and growing , so only has one outlet set up at this time .
